Quoted from Thermionic:

Maybe, but I trust Marco a lot more than some random overseas eBay merchant to not only sell genuine parts, but also to actually ship them to me, so the price premium is probably worth it for the peace of mind alone.

I completely understand, and don't blame you at all. I automatically assume all parts from China are counterfeit, but if they work I don't care anymore than the company that can legally manufacture them and chooses not to; for all I know the same part I'm getting from China is coming of the exact same assembly line as the "official" ST part did.

I buy parts for a different reason than the average pin owner as I don't buy parts specifically to fix a single failure on a machine, but to repair boards in the long term so I often bulk buy parts. I've had fairly good luck with the parts coming from China and so far I've had only had one bad lot of 10 CPUs that came in with a 100% fail rate and these were rejected and a full refunded was received. In the past, I've purchased lots of CPUs, ASICs, NVRAM, and IR EPROMS that all tested 100% operable when received; I did purchase a lot of ten VN02N that I linked above and will install 2 of them into a 100% operational board for testing when I receive them, if they both work I will assume all 10 are good; if not, I'll reject the whole lot and get a refund.

Side note: I've purchased 1 WPC CPU from Marco and it was DOA, they did ship me a new one for free right away so that was a win...but the cost of the one part with shipping was the same as buying 10 shipped from China.
